Is authoritarianism winning, or is democracy just failing to deliver? Communications strategist Sally Kohn lays out how democracy has evolved before and why it must evolve again, into what she calls "Democracy 3.0" — a version that finally shares power and opportunity equally. "We the people demand that our politics and our economy work way better for us," says Kohn. ---------------------------------------- Hosted on Acast. What music is for | Wallis Bird

Irish musician and songwriter Wallis Bird received her first guitar at six months old and has been chasing music ever since. After her TED2026 performance of three genre-bending original songs, Wallis sat down with TED music curator Anna Bulbrook – a musician herself – to talk about the cosmic energy she taps into on stage, and what drives her songwriting. Their conversation explores her lifelong pull toward music, the stories hidden inside her songs, and how creativity can heal. It's woven through Wallis's electrifying, deeply moving performance, as she sings about joy, grief, social struggle, and what it takes to use music to bring people together, even when the world gives you every reason to look away.
